Francesco Bagnaia was left relieved to have survived a tough opening portion of the Thai Grand Prix, the Italian remarking

The factory Ducati racer had a better start in the race compared to the previous day’s sprint encounter. He moved up to fourth position at the start but soon found himself in a tough battle with KTM’s Brad Binder, who made a tough move on him, causing him to drop back to sixth. Because of the intense nature of the battle, he had to abandon his plan of saving his rear tire and push hard to catch up to the leaders. He couldn’t pass the front runners and finished third, but later moved up to second after Binder was penalized. Despite the reduced points advantage, he considered the result not bad considering the circumstances. He nearly made a great overtake around the outside at the final corner but was run wide by another rider. He felt that his overtakes during the race were some of the best he has made in years.
